Have you ever watched a real estate investment infomercial and wondered if you should order the valuable information? Read HOUSES OF CARDS first! In 1995, in Akron Ohio, Jennifer is under the influence of late-night gurus promising wealth beyond her wildest expectations. Together with her husband, Tim, and son, Nathan, they embark on an unforgettable adventure. The first house cost only $6,500--charged to their credit cards. Spanning eight years and twelve house renovations the family learns the cost of pursuing their dream. They encounter outrageous tenants, unimaginable filth, clogged toilets and Emergency room visits. In the end, a fall from a ladder changes everything. HOUSES OF CARDS will appeal to men and women--anyone who's been tempted by real estate, investment-infomercials--anyone who can identify with the frustrations of home renovations.
